Upshur County Election Results

Please note: These are the totals from Upshur County only. The candidates in bold are currently leading. Because Election Day, June 9, is also the deadline for absentee ballots to be mailed, these results could change over the coming days.

Last Update – 9:20 p.m. on June 9, 2020. All precincts reporting.

Buckhannon Mayor (Non–partisan)

  • Robbie Skinner – 703
  • Mike Bodnar – 41
  • David McCauley – 540

Buckhannon City Recorder (Non–partisan)

  • Randy Sanders – 714
  • Abigail Benjamin – 490

Buckhannon City Council (Non–partisan, three seats)

  • Jack L. Reger – 531
  • CJ Rylands – 423 (tie)
  • Shauna Jones – 354
  • Matt Kerner – 236
  • Freddy L. Suder – 164
  • Steve Oldaker – 243
  • Pamela Cuppari Bucklew – 523
  • Rick Edwards – 96
  • Scott Preston – 380
  • Shelia Sines – 423 (tie)

Upshur County Board of Education (Non–partisan, two seats)

  • Pat Long – 2,404
  • Graham Godwin – 2,050
  • Tammy Jo Samples – 3,563
  • David Bush – 1,841

W.Va. House of Delegates – 45th District (Republican)

  • Carl ‘Robbie’ Martin – 1,563
  • Gary Connell – 1,030
  • Charlene ‘Shaffer’ Dean – 686

State Senate – 11th District (Republican)

  • John ‘J.R.’ Pitsenbarger – 1,773
  • Robert Lee Karnes – 2,257

Buckhannon Public Library Levy

  • For the Levies – 846
  • Against the Levies – 372

Voter turnout: 45%
